    Have any questions for a car reviewer writing about the Mirage?

    I know of someone who's going to be reviewing the Mirage (Philippines) in the near future, which got me wondering:

    Do you have any questions you'd like to ask a car reviewer?

    Is there some aspect of the car that isn't written about that you'd like to see covered? Any common misconceptions/errors in reporting you'd like to see avoided?

    No guarantees at all that we'll get a public response from this person, but I'll certainly pass on this thread to him.

    A few things I can think of:

    --- On the strictly technical side of things, I'd like to see the details of the MIVEC valve control system ironed out. (Some confusion about whether it operates on just the intake side alone, or on intake + exhaust.)

    --- Naturally, I'd like to see a more detailed fuel economy report. We've been getting very undescriptive reports in the press - sometimes consumption figures, but no context. Ideally, I'd like to know a few "constant speed" readings too (ie. what the car gets at a steady 80, 90, 100 km/h).
